Im not really sure about the staling, but iv had the oil problem a few times, since its on the ceramic i dont think it originated in the combustion chamber, sounds like a bad valvecover gasket&seals, when that goes bad it lets oil just make a puddle in you sparkplug holes and whn you take them out it covers the whole plug. i had to use a turkey baster to get all the oil out before i took out my plugs.as for the stalling that could be completely unrelated

well if your sure the oil came from inside the cylinder there is only three ways it gets in there, valve seals, rings, and head gasket but i cant see any of them making it "dripping" wet
